Seed No. 1, Rafael Nadal, speaks about how it feels to be a father in the post-match interview of the first round of the Australian Open. Earlier today, Rafa won his first-round match against Jack Draper. In the post-match interview, he opened up about being a dad and said it was one of the most beautiful things.ย 

Rafa began his title defense with a hard-fought 7-5, 2-6, 6-4, 6-1 victory over Jack. The match went on for about three and a half hours and had some beautiful rallies throughout.

When reminded of him being a dad, the Spaniard said, Yeah!! it’s true.” And he went on to say, “Well, as for everybody knows, it is one of the most beautiful things in life without a doubt. So enjoying this new moment, having fans super happy and grateful to have them with me here in Australia, that helps a lot. So I’m happy to able to play tennis in this stage of my career after being home months. I’m very grateful.”

Rafael Nadal talks about his first round and upcoming challenges

The top seed, Rafael Nadal, had no easy first round. The match had everything a fan expected. Rafa lost a set 2-6 in which Jack broke his serve twice consecutively. There was a rain interruption for the match, and not to forget, Rafa lost one of his racquets. However, Rafa said in the post-match press conference that he was happy about this win, no matter how he won it. He also said that he needed this win after a few defeats earlier this year in the United Cup.ย 

He also said he was not impressed with Jack’s performance as he felt he has the potential to do a lot better. Jack had a cramp during the 4th set of the match and hence lost his rhythm towards the end. The 36-year-old wished him a speedy recovery and said he was happy to win against a great player. Speaking about whether his baby is an extra motivation, he said “No. I have been always enough excited to play every single tournament. My approach to the competition is not changing much being dad or not.”

The world No.2 plays the American, Mackenzie Mcdonald in the next round on Wednesday. Mackenzie had a tough outing in the first round having to play a five-setter. Overall, it will another exciting context for the defending champion.
